Warning Signs You Need Condo Water Damage Restoration

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common warning signs of condo water damage: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old or mildew. If you notice a persistent smell, it’s time to call us in.

Water Stains on the Ceiling or Walls

Water stains can be a sign of a leak or water damage. Don’t ignore them, they can lead to bigger problems if left unchecked.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

If your flooring is warped or buckled, it may be a sign of water damage. We can assess the damage and provide a plan for repair.

Discoloration or Warping of Wood or Drywall

Discoloration or warping of wood or drywall can show water damage. We’ll assess the damage and provide a plan for repair or replacement.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Unusual sounds or leaks can show a problem with your plumbing or HVAC system. We’ll identify the source of the issue and provide a plan for repair.

Visible Signs of Mold or Mildew

Visible signs of mold or mildew can be a sign of a serious problem. We’ll assess the damage and provide a plan for remediation and prevention.

Condo Water Damage Restoration Cost in Powell’s Point, NC

The cost of condo water damage restoration in Powell’s Point, NC, will depend on the severity and scope of the damage, as well as the size of the affected area.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Mold Remediation and Sanitizing $1,000 – $5,000 Extent of mold growth, size of affected area
Reconstruction and Repair $2,000 – $10,000 Extent of damage, materials needed for repair
Final Inspection and Quality Control $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, complexity of repair

Keep in mind that these est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on your specific situation. We’ll provide a detailed estimate for your condo water damage restoration project after assessing the damage and developing a customized plan.

Common Questions About Condo Water Damage Restoration

Q: How long will the restoration process take?

A: The length of time required for condo water damage restoration will depend on the severity and scope of the damage, as well as the size of the affected area. On average, our team can complete a typical condo water damage restoration project within 3-5 days. But, this timeframe may vary depending on the specific circumstances.

Q: Will my condo be safe to occupy during the restoration process?

A: No, it’s not safe to occupy your condo during the restoration process. Our team will work to ensure your property is safe and secure, but it’s essential to vacate the premises to prevent further damage or injury.

Q: Will my insurance cover the costs of condo water damage restoration?

A: It’s possible that your insurance will cover some or all of the costs associated with condo water damage restoration. But, this will depend on the specifics of your policy and the circumstances surrounding the damage. Our team will work with you to navigate the insurance claims process and ensure you receive the coverage you’re entitled to.

Q: Can I prevent condo water damage in the future?

A: Yes, there are steps you can take to prevent condo water damage in the future. Regular maintenance, such as inspecting your plumbing and HVAC systems, can help identify potential issues before they become major problems. Also, keeping an eye out for warning signs, such as water stains or musty odors, can help you catch issues early and prevent further damage.

Q: What happens if I ignore condo water damage?

A: Ignoring condo water damage can lead to more extensive and costly repairs down the line. Mold and mildew can grow, causing health risks and further damage to your property. It’s essential to address condo water damage quickly to prevent these issues and ensure your property remains safe and secure.
